Bedford Middle School 7th Grade Student Wins Essay Contest
Sofia Alarcon-Frias was the Middle School Division Grand Prize winner in the 2019 Altice USA Hispanic Heritage Month Essay Contest.

WESTPORT, CT — Bedford Middle School 7th grader Sofia Alarcon-Frias was named the Middle School Division Grand Prize winner in the 2019 Altice USAHispanic Heritage Month Essay Contest, the school announced. Her victory was celebrated at the school on Dec. 13.
Sofia's winning essay, "An Unstoppable Dreamer," is a celebration of the life of Edith Straheli, Sofia's grandmother, who endured arrest, incarceration, and deportation in Argentina for educating the poor in her area.
During the ceremony, which was attended by Westport First Selectman Jim Marpe, Bedford Principal Adam Rosen, BMS language arts teacher Paul Ferrante, and Sofia's parents, Natalia and Claudio, she read an excerpt from her essay and was awarded a grand prize scholarship check for $1,500 by Allison Aylward, Community Affairs Manager for Altice USA.
